40 firefighters tackle New Forest house blaze


AROUND 40 firefighters from across Dorset, Hampshire and Wiltshire were called to a Fire at a house in the New Forest early this morning.

The fire at the detached house in the centre of Martin near Fordingbridge around 2am caused severe damage to the ground floor and roof.

The occupiers of the house in Main Road escaped unhurt and the fire was extinguished by around 4.45am.

Fire crews from Fordingbridge, Ringwood, Cranborne, Verwood, Salisbury, Wilton, Beaulieu, Eastleigh and St Mary's in Southampton attended.

The cause of the fire is being investigated.
